    Design of Miniaturization Wilkinson Eighteen-Way Power Divider Using Real Frequency Technique

    • Wilkinson eighteen-way power divider in 100MHz can be miniaturization by using Real Frequency Technique, which is an efficient method for the optimization design of broadband matching network. Uusing classic real frequency technique for the matching network design is smaller than quarter wavelength converter As a result, the size is cut short By measuring eighteen-way power divider, its size is only 10*10cm2, the insert loss is less then 13.5dB, the ripple is less then 0.2dB, and the insulation is more then 18dB.
